The Comprehensive Guide to Single Oven Electric Ranges
In contemporary kitchen areas, the electric range has actually ended up being a main fixture, known for its benefit, performance, and versatility. Among the numerous types of electric ranges readily available, the single oven electric range stands out for its practicality and viability for various cooking styles. This post delves into everything you need to learn about single oven electric varieties, including their benefits, functions, maintenance suggestions, and responses to typical concerns.
Comprehending Single Oven Electric Ranges
A single oven electric range typically includes an electric cooktop with four to five burners together with one oven compartment, either situated below the cooktop or in a freestanding setup. These varieties come with various functionalities including baking, broiling, and typically, specialized cooking modes.

To make sure durability and efficiency, regular maintenance of an electric range is vital. The following list details effective maintenance practices:

Regular Cleaning:
Wipe down the cooktop after each usage to prevent build-up of food particles and spots.Tidy the oven before the accumulation of grease and grime ends up being unmanageable.
Look for Damage:
Inspect electrical connections regularly to prevent fire risks.Look for fractures on the cooktop surface and change if essential.
Evaluate the Temperature:
Regularly examine the oven temperature level using an oven thermometer to make sure accurate cooking.
Examine Seals:
Ensure that door seals are intact to keep optimal heat retention.Pricing and Common Brands
